Philippines granted independence by the United States starting the Third Philippine Republic. Empire of Japan. WebIn 1840, after languishing in jail for 14 years, Fr. Juan Severino Mallari was hanged for his crimes as the first (and perhaps the only) documented serial killer in the Philippines. He was also the first Filipino priest executed by the Spanish colonial government, predating the more famous GomBurZa by 32 years (the combined last names of three ...

It was led by Pedro Ambaristo with its events … WebThis program encouraged Filipinos to obtain education in the United States and return to the Philippines. The first year of the program there were about 20,000 applicants with only one hundred of Filipinos men ultimately selected to study abroad in the United States. About forty boys and eight girls were chosen each year in 1904 and 1905.
